Lafayette vs Palm Bay-Melbourne-Titusville

Fair Market Rent Comparison — HUD 2025 Data

Quick Answer

Lafayette is 43% cheaper for renters. A 2-bedroom rents for $741/mo vs $1,057/mo in Palm Bay-Melbourne-Titusville — saving $3,792/year.

Rent by Unit Size

Unit SizeLafayettePalm Bay-Melbourne-TitusvilleDifference
Studio$502$712$210
1 Bedroom$626$871$245
2 Bedrooms$741$1,057$316
3 Bedrooms$958$1,335$377
4 Bedrooms$1,134$1,531$397
Median Income$38,989$62,156$23,167
